Fostering Teaching-Learning through Workplace Based Assessment in Postgraduate Chemical Pathology Residency Program Using Virtual Learning Environment

Abstract: Background The principle of workplace based assessment (WBA) is to assess trainees at work with feedback integrated into the program simultaneously. A student driven WBA model was introduced and perception evaluation of this teaching method was done subsequently by taking feedback from the faculty as well as the postgraduate trainees (PGs) of a residency program.
